HORI7ON celebrates music and school days with ANCHORs during their 2nd concert “DAYTOUR: ANCHOR HIGH”

The lovely boy group, HORI7ON, has once again bonded with their ANCHORs during the group’s latest “DAYTOUR: ANCHOR HIGH” concert held at the Mall of Asia Arena last November 3, 2024.

This marks HORI7ON’s second concert in Manila, after their successful “Friend-SHIP: Voyage To Manila” show in September 2023.

Starting off with high-energy performances of “Sumayaw Sumunod,” “Lovey-Dovey,” and a full-group version of Marcus, Jeromy, and LAPILLUS’ Haeun’s unit song “How You Feel,” HORI7ON was warmly welcomed by their fans for the concert.

They proceeded to perform 2 new, unreleased tracks: “Cold,” written by Marcus and Vinci, and “2Cool2Care,” written by Marcus; eagerly surprising fans.

For this concert, HORI7ON prepared special solo performances that highlight each member’s individual charms and talent. Kim sang a delightful cover of “YK” by Cean Jr., making hearts flutter with his soft vocals and guitar-playing. Kyler showed his sweet side, singing “I Think They Call This Love” by Elliot James Reay while handing out flowers to the audience.

Winston allured the audience with his earnest cover of “Off My Face” by Justin Bieber, displaying his distinct vocal quality. Marcus amazed the audience with his smooth dance moves and live vocals for a cover of “Rainism” by Korean artist Rain. Vinci’s performance of “Falling” by Harry Styles left everyone wanting more because of his impressive voice and high notes.

Reyster’s self-choreographed dance number for “Die With a Smile” made a mark with his creative and graceful interpretative take on the song. Jeromy changed the vibes with his hip-hop dance steps that proved why he was main dancer. Soon after, he was joined by fellow “Maknae Line” members Marcus and Winston for a lively performance of “Butter” by BTS.

In line with the concert’s high school theme, HORI7ON participated in a fun spelling segment where ANCHORs got to see the boys’ knowledge, wits, and genuine reactions. Meanwhile, some members also shared their memories of school. Marcus said he was homeschooled, so he gave a shout to his teacher instead. Vinci told Reyster’s story about being part of the top 10 in school after studying hard because of his past crush.

As a treat to their pre-debut fans, HORI7ON performed some of their songs from Dream Maker such as “Odd Eye,” “Tiger,” “Hit Me,” bringing excitement to enthusiasts of the survival show. The group also delivered intense performances of “Meteor” and a rock version of their pre-debut single “Dash.” To shift the atmosphere, HORI7ON serenaded fans with performances of their signature ballads, “Mama” and “Salamat.”

Throughout the concert, the members expressed gratitude to everyone who continues to support them. Surprising fans, the boys brought out individual handwritten letters that they prepared to read aloud, which conveyed their honest feelings towards ANCHORs. Marcus shed tears reading his, because of the overwhelming emotions he felt.

📷: @HORI7ONofficial (on X)

During the encore, HORI7ON performed “SIX7EEN,” “Lucky,” “Sumayaw Sumunod” a second time, and repeated stages of “Birthday,” enjoying a cheerful and good time with everyone.

In order to repay HORI7ON’s efforts for the concert, ANCHORs prepared several fan projects such as a hand banner stating “Beyond the line where stars align, HORI7ON shine,” as well as a surprise video and cake event with a special appearance by HORI7ON’s mascot, Gavin.
